Salary overview
The median wage for Diagnostic Medical Sonographers in Greenville, NC is $76,380 per year, 20.9% below the national median of $96,590. Pay ranges from under $62,250 at the tenth percentile to more than $97,900 at the ninetieth, with the interquartile range running from $66,050 to $81,160.
The area has 120 jobs in this occupation, which works out to 1.5 of every thousand jobs. Greensboro leads the state's metro areas for this occupation, at $98,890. Set against every other occupation measured in the same area, it ranks 68th of 289 by median pay.

What the pay is worth locally
Prices in Greenville run 5.7% below the national average, so the median of $76,380 goes as far as $80,997 would elsewhere in the country. Measured that way it compares to the national median at 16.1% below the national median in real terms.
